Home › Cars › Car parts by brand › XRAY Parts › (X 301219) COMPOSITE UPPER HOLDER FOR BUMPER FOR ADJUSTABLE BODY MOUNTS
COMPOSITE UPPER HOLDER FOR BUMPER FOR ADJUSTABLE BODY MOUNTS
€ 8.95
Available - Inventory: 1